Default Pro Tools LE 7.4 & Waves Plug Ins

Hello, I'm using Pro Tools LE 7.4 with a Rack 003 now and also Digital Performer with a MotU Interface on the same computer. I installed the Waves Gold Bundle native Plug Ins, because I've bought these for my former DP system. With that it works without any problems.
In the Pro Tools software the plug ins are not identified and do not appear.
Now I'm not sure if I should have had Waves Gold Bundle TDM, but isn't Pro Tools LE native?
Can anybody tell me if my plug ins have to work on PT or not?

What version are the Waves plugins? My guess is that you don't have the updated version needed to run in Protools 7.4. It is either 5.9 or 6.0 that you need to have. Check with the waves site for the exact specs. If you do have the most up to date version, than it is possible that when you installed waves, you only installed the au versions, because at the time you didn't need rtas (protools), in which case you should be able to just reinstall waves, making sure that rtas, au and vtas are all checked off.
